Twisted Bread with Margarine - A Fluffy and Delicious Treat
Preparation time: 15 minutes
Rising time: 1 hour
Baking time: 1 hour
Total: approximately 2 hours
Number of servings: 10 slices

Necessary Ingredients
- 400 g high-quality white flour
- 210 ml fresh milk
- 50 g margarine (melted and cooled)
- 60 ml water (warm)
- 1 packet of dry yeast (approximately 7 g)
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 teaspoon sugar
- 1 egg (for brushing)
- 2 tablespoons milk (for brushing)
Ingredient Details
White flour is the base of this recipe, providing the desired structure to the bread. Choose bread flour, which has a higher protein content, to achieve a more elastic dough. Milk adds moisture and a rich flavor, while margarine contributes to a fluffy texture. Dry yeast is essential for making the dough rise, and salt and sugar balance the flavors.
Step by Step - Preparation Guide
1. Preparing the Ingredients
Start by gathering all the necessary ingredients. Make sure the milk and water are warm, not hot, to activate the yeast without destroying it.
2. Adding Ingredients to the Bread Machine
Place the ingredients in the bread machine in the following order:
- Milk
- Water
- Melted and cooled margarine
- Flour
- Salt
- Sugar
- Yeast
This order is crucial to ensure effective yeast activity and uniform dough development.
3. Selecting the Program
Set the bread machine to the kneading program. This step will take a few minutes, during which the dough will begin to form and become elastic.
4. Allowing to Rise
After the program is complete, let the dough rise in the machine for about 30 minutes. This time will allow the yeast to act and develop air in the dough.
5. Shaping the Dough
Once the dough has risen, turn it out onto a well-floured work surface. Divide it into three equal pieces. Shape each piece into a long strand, ensuring they are of uniform size for even baking.
6. Braiding the Strands
Join the three strands at one end and start braiding them carefully. Braiding will not only give a beautiful presentation to the bread but will also create an interesting texture. Make sure to secure the ends well so they do not come apart during baking.
7. Placing in the Pan
Place the braided bread in a loaf pan lined with parchment paper. This will prevent sticking and make it easier to remove the bread after baking.
8. Final Rise
Let the bread rise again, covered with a clean towel, for about 20-30 minutes. This final rising time will help the bread become even fluffier.
9. Preparing for Baking
In a small bowl, beat one egg with two tablespoons of milk. Use this mixture to brush the surface of the braided bread. This will help achieve a golden and shiny crust.
10. Baking
Preheat the oven to 180°C. Bake the bread for about an hour, or until it turns golden and sounds hollow when tapped lightly on the bottom. Use a kitchen thermometer to check the internal temperature; it should be about 90°C.
11. Cooling
After removing the bread from the oven, let it c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then transfer it to a cooling rack. Allow it to cool completely before slicing.
Serving Suggestions
This braided bread is delicious both warm and cold. You can serve it plain, spread with butter or jam, or alongside a warm soup or salad. It is also perfect for savory sandwiches or sweet-filled pastries.
Variations and Tips
- Adding Herbs: You can add dried herbs or spices, such as oregano or rosemary, to the dough for extra flavor.
- Enriching with Seeds: Sprinkle sesame or poppy seeds on top before baking for an interesting look and texture.
- Sweet Bread: Replace some of the flour with almond flour and add brown sugar and cinnamon to create a sweet bread perfect for breakfast.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. Why isn’t my dough rising?
Make sure the yeast is fresh and that the ingredients are at the right temperature. Also, check the room temperature; the dough prefers a warm environment to rise.
2. Can I use butter instead of margarine?
Yes, butter will provide a rich flavor and delicious texture. Make sure it is softened to incorporate well into the dough.
3. How can I keep the bread fresh longer?
Store the bread in an airtight container at room temperature or wrap it in aluminum foil to prevent drying out.
